Need to tell parents of my kid’s friend something awkward by WildViolet89 in Parenting

[–]AHaydenL 0 points1 point  (0 children)

OP kudos to you for maintaining your calm and you've gotten some awesome responses here. Chiming in best I can without being too wordy. Weirdly the curiosity about genitals is developmentally normal as others here have said, but also agree that the line is totally crossed when there is touch (violation of personal boundaries and bodily autonomy) and threats (violation of personal safety) are involved.

The way I understand it from a developmental psychology point of view is- Given that both are 5 year olds I doubt there's anything sexual in nature in the friend's mind.. More like the developmentally normal stage of exploring how much power and control one has over social interactions and others (although, other folks with experience dealing with 5 year olds and abuse please feel free to correct me if I'm wrong).

Regardless, both kids need to know that trying to view or touch another person without consent, and to make threats against safety, is most definitely NOT within the realms of anyone's power and control.

This is ideally a line drawn and held by primary caregivers/parents, and depending on their response and how responsible they are, society at large (including CPS). I agree with another poster that in general, CPS is good at weeding out cases that truly deserve attention so reporting is not necessarily a bad move, but also think that is up to your judgement.

And of course you need to protect your son, who is trying to figure out his own power and control in his own world. He probably needs to practice the very difficult skill of saying no whenever he feels like something isn't quite right. He needs to know he can safely notify you or other trusted adults for help, which I think is something you've done amazing to be supportive about.

I will admit that friendships at the age of 5 are a tad mysterious. How much do 5 year old friends mean to each other? Do they happen to be good friends because one is naturally more bossy and one more accommodating (because this power struggle, so to speak, is the developmental theme for preschoolers). Is it devastating to lose that friend (how often do they see each other and voluntarily play with each other)? How will that friend react to being told to stop doing this (totally depends on how his parents approach it)? But bottom line, raise it to the parents for sure. And you can't control how they react (if they yell at their kid or do nothing) but you've certainly done your best.
